As a pediatric cardiologist, Dr. David J. Steflik's services would be specifically focused on the cardiovascular health of infants, children, and adolescents. These services typically encompass a comprehensive range of diagnostic, treatment, and management options for various pediatric heart conditions, including:

  • Comprehensive Pediatric Cardiac Evaluations: Thorough assessments of a child's cardiovascular health, including a review of medical history (including prenatal history), physical examinations, and evaluation of any symptoms or concerns related to the heart.
  • Electrocardiogram (ECG/EKG): A non-invasive test that records the electrical activity of a child's heart, helping to diagnose arrhythmias and other electrical abnormalities.
  • Echocardiography: An ultrasound imaging technique specifically adapted for children to visualize the structure and function of the heart, including the heart chambers, valves, and blood flow. This is a crucial tool for diagnosing congenital heart defects and other pediatric cardiac conditions.
  • Fetal Echocardiography: Specialized ultrasound performed during pregnancy to assess the baby's heart development and identify potential congenital heart defects before birth. The availability of this service with Dr. Steflik would need to be confirmed with his office.
  • Exercise Stress Testing: For older children and adolescents, this test monitors the heart's performance during physical activity to assess exercise tolerance and identify any exercise-induced cardiac issues.
  • Holter and Event Monitoring: Portable devices used to continuously or intermittently record a child's heart rhythm over an extended period to detect infrequent or transient arrhythmias.
  • Management of Congenital Heart Defects: Diagnosis and medical management of structural abnormalities of the heart present at birth. This may involve collaboration with pediatric cardiac surgeons for surgical interventions when necessary.
  • Management of Acquired Heart Conditions: Treatment of heart conditions that develop after birth, such as Kawasaki disease, myocarditis, and rheumatic fever.
  • Evaluation and Management of Arrhythmias: Diagnosis and treatment of irregular heart rhythms in children and adolescents.
  • Assessment of Chest Pain, Palpitations, and Syncope (Fainting) in Children: Determining the cardiac or non-cardiac causes of these symptoms in young patients.
  • Pre-operative Cardiac Evaluations: Assessing the cardiac health of children undergoing non-cardiac surgeries.
